Inconel 601 Welded Pipes offer remarkable versatility and unparalleled performance in the most demanding industrial environments. This material, a blend of nickel, chromium, and iron, is the foundation of these pipes. The key elements are balanced to enhance their mechanical and physical properties. The alloy also contains a mix of aluminium and silicon along with trace amounts of several other elements, such as titanium, copper, manganese, and molybdenum, contributing to its high oxidation resistance and corrosion resistance. Furthermore, Inconel 601 Welded Pipes exhibit exceptional thermodynamic stability and remarkable mechanical strength even under extreme temperatures, ensuring they maintain their structural integrity while operational in diverse industrial applications. Thus, this unique chemical composition makes Inconel 601 Welded Pipes the optimal solution for industries seeking high-strength, long-lasting materials capable of withstanding harsh conditions.
